The Unrivaled History of the Dodgers and Yankees
Let's be real, guys, the Dodgers and the Yankees aren't just any old teams. They're dynasties, each boasting a trophy case that could make Fort Knox jealous. The Yankees, with their 27 World Series titles, are practically synonymous with winning. They've dominated the sport for decades, fueled by legendary players and a relentless pursuit of excellence. From Babe Ruth to Derek Jeter, the pinstripes have been home to some of the greatest to ever play the game. And their home, Yankee Stadium, is a cathedral of baseball, a place where dreams are made and legends are born. On the other hand, the Dodgers, initially based in Brooklyn, have a rich history of their own. Their move to Los Angeles brought a whole new chapter, and they've become a symbol of Southern California cool. The Boys in Blue have a passionate fanbase, a knack for developing talent, and a history of thrilling playoff runs. They’ve captured multiple World Series titles and consistently field competitive teams.
